THE PRIME MINISTER | SOCIALIST REPUBLIC OF VIETNAM |
No. 274/QD-TTg | Hanoi, February 18, 2020 |
DECISION
APPROVAL FOR ENVIRONMENTAL PROTECTION PLANNING TASKS DURING 2021 – 2030 AND THE VISION FOR 2050
THE PRIME MINISTER
Pursuant to the Law on Government Organization dated June 19, 2015;
Pursuant to the Law on Environment Protection dated June 23, 2014;
Pursuant to the Law on Planning dated November 24, 2017;
Pursuant to the Law dated November 20, 2018 on Amendments to 37 Planning-related Laws;
Pursuant to the Government's Decree No. 37/2019/ND-CP dated May 07, 2019 elaborating some Articles of the Law on Planning
At the request of the Minister of Natural Resources and Environment,
DECIDES:
Article 1. Approval for National Environmental Protection Planning tasks during 2021 – 2030 and the vision for 2050 with the following contents:
1. Planning name, period, scope
a) Planning name: National Environmental Protection Planning
b) Planning period: 2021– 2030 with a vision for 2050.
c) Planning scope: The entire Vietnam’s territory, including territorial land, sea and islands, divided into planning regions, administrative divisions and river basins according to their natural characteristics, economic and social conditions.
d) Study subjects of the planning: natural conditions; climate change; socio-economic conditions; environmental quality; natural scenery and biodiversity; hazardous wastes, solid wastes; environmental monitoring and warning.
2. Requirements regarding viewpoints, principles and objectives of the planning
a) Viewpoint requirements
- Specify policies and guidelines of the Communist Party and the law on enhanced management of resources, environmental protection and sustainable development of the country; conformity with regulations of law on planning, environmental protection and relevant laws;
- Effectively serve state management of environmental protection;
- Prevent and control pollution; management of hazardous wastes and solid wastes; environment recovery and remediation; biodiversity and biopreservation;
- Uniformly and selectively inherit the contents, viewpoints, objectives and outcomes of the implementation of National Environmental Protection Strategy by 2020 with a vision for 2030 in the Prime Minister’s Decision No. 1216/QD-TTg dated September 05, 2012.
b) Requirements regarding principles of environmental protection planning
- The environmental protection planning must be conformable with the national master plan, the national marine spatial planning, national land use planning; policies, guidelines and laws on planning, socio-economic development and environmental protection;
- Ensure uniformity of subjects and contents of between the regional, provincial and national environmental protection plannings;
- Be appropriate for the natural and socio-economic conditions; the socio-economic development strategy, defense and security; national strategy for environmental protection and sustainable development of the country;
- Satisfy with international cooperation requirements and comply with relevant international treaties to which the Socialist Republic of Vietnam is a signatory.
c) Requirements regarding objectives of national environmental protection planning
- General objectives and visions: Identify basic and key objectives in order to serve reasonable use of resources, control of sources of pollution, waste management, environmental quality management, conservation of nature and biodiversity, adaptation to climate change, establishment of fundamental conditions for a green economy with reduced wastes, low carbon and sustainable development of the country.
- Specific objectives: Quantify specific objectives regarding establishment of strictly protected areas and emission control areas; establishment of areas for protection and conservation of nature and biodiversity; establishment of areas for concentrated management of solid wastes and hazardous wastes; establishment of a nationwide environmental quality monitoring and warning network during the 2021 – 2030 period and a vision for 2050.
3. Requirements regarding planning methods and contents
a) Planning contents
Planning contents shall comply with regulations of the Law on Planning and the Government's Decree No. 37/2019/ND-CP dated May 07, 2019 elaborating some Articles of the Law on Planning, including the following primary contents:
- Assessment of the current status and developments of environmental quality, natural scenery and biodiversity; current situation and forecasts of waste production; impacts of climate change; current situation of environmental protection and management:
+ Natural conditions, socio-economic conditions at the beginning of the planning period;
+ The situation in the beginning of the planning period; environment developments over the previous planning period, including: soil quality in areas affected by chemical warfare, areas with industrial zones, factories, warehouses of chemicals, plant protection chemicals, landfills, closed or relocated trade villages, hazardous mineral extraction sites, mineral extraction sites using hazardous chemicals that have been closed, farming areas using a large amount of chemicals in the planning area; water quality in sea areas, coastal sea areas, rivers, river segments, lakes, ponds, channels, canals, especially in areas with multiple sources of wastewater or with major sources of wastewater, environmentally sensitive areas; air quality in urban areas, residential areas, areas with industrial production, trade villages, areas with multiple or major sources of industrial emission;
+ Assessment of the overall situation at the beginning of the planning period, nationwide developments of natural scenery and biodiversity, natural ecosystems, flora and fauna species, and genetic resources; thematic assessment of areas with high biodiversity, important wetlands and natural scenery, biodiversity corridors, wildlife sanctuaries, biodiversity conservation centers;
+ Assessment of production of wastes during the previous planning period and forecasts about the quantity and characteristics of the wastes produced during the planning period, including: industrial wastewater, domestic wastewater and other types of wastewater; industrial emission, exhaust gas from vehicles, other exhaust gases; common industrial solid wastes, construction solid wastes, solid wastes from production of agricultural products and by-products; domestic wastes from urban areas, rural areas and trade villages; hazardous wastes; other distinctive wastes; thematic assessments of hazardous waste treatment facilities, facilities and areas where solid domestic wastes and other solid wastes are treated and buried;
+ Assessment of the impacts of climate change in the previous planning period and forecasts about impacts of climate change on environmental quality and biodiversity in the current planning period;
+ Assessment of environmental protection and management, including: environment management by Ministries, central authorities and local governments; environmental protection and management by enterprises, communities and participation of social organizations and the people; promulgation of environment-related legislative documents, technical regulations, standards, procedures, economic-technical norms; compartmentalization in environmental management; conservation of nature and biodiversity; management of solid wastes and hazardous wastes; environmental warning and monitoring in the previous planning period; major environmental issues and challenges in the current planning period;
+ Assessment of implementation of other plannings relevant to environmental zoning; conservation of nature and biodiversity; management of solid wastes and hazardous wastes; environmental warning and monitoring.
- Environmental protection viewpoints, objectives, tasks and solutions:
+ Establish the viewpoints on environmental protection in the planning period;
+ Determined overall objectives and specific objectives of environmental protection for the 10-year planning period and the vision for the next 30 – 50 years;
+ Determine environmental protection tasks and solutions, including minimization of impacts of socio-economic development on the environment; control of pollution sources, waste management; management and improvement of environment quality; conservation of nature and biodiversity;
+ Establish rules and mechanisms for cooperation between central and local authorities in environmental zoning, conservation of nature and biodiversity, management of solid wastes and hazardous wastes; environmental warning and monitoring.
- Plan the establishment of environmental regions; establish nature and biodiversity conservation and protection areas; establish areas for concentrated treatment of solid wastes and hazardous wastes; establish an environment warning and monitoring network in the planning:
+ Clarify the purposes, requirements, definitions, connotations and criteria for establishment of strictly protected areas, emission control areas; orient establishment of strictly protected areas and emission control areas nationwide;
+ Criteria and orientation for establishment of areas with high level of biodiversity, important natural scenery, important wetlands, biodiversity corridors, wildlife sanctuaries and biodiversity conservation centers;
+ Plan the location, scale, type of wastes, technologies, scope of receipt of solid wastes and hazardous wastes for treatment at national, regional and provincial levels;
+ Plan the monitoring frequency, parameters and points of the national, inter-provincial and provincial network for soil, water, air quality monitoring and warning.
- List of projects of national importance, prioritized projects and order of priority:
+ Establishment of criteria for selection of prioritized environmental protection projects in the planning period;
+Rationales for compilation of the list of environmental protection projects of national importance, proposed order of priority and execution stages thereof.
- Solutions and resources for implementation of the planning in terms of: dissemination of knowledge, raising awareness of the public; mechanisms and policies; science and technology; finance and investment; training; international cooperation; organization and supervision of planning implementation.
- Preparation of the planning reports, including: consolidated report, summary report, diagrams, maps and database about the subjects of national environmental protection planning. The list and scale of national environmental protection planning maps are provided in Appendix I of Decree No. 37/2019/ND-CP.
b) Planning methods include:
- Inheritance method;
- Investigation, survey methods;
- Statistics and data processing method;
- Quick assessment method;
- Analysis, consolidation method;
- Overlay and geographic information system (GIS) methods;
- Expert method;
- System analysis method;
- Matrix method;
- Cost-benefit analysis method;
- SWOT (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ats) analysis method;
- Community survey method;
- Other methods that are appropriate for the procedures for development of the national environmental protection planning.
4. Time limit
The planning shall be completed within 24 months from the day on which the National Environmental Protection Planning tasks during 2021 – 2030 and the vision for 2050 are approved by the Prime Minister.
5. Composition, quantity, formats of planning documents
a) Planning documents include:
- The written request for the Prime Minister’s approval for the National Environmental Protection Planning during 2021- 2030 and the vision for 2050.
- The draft Decision on Approval for the National Environmental Protection Planning during 2021 – 2030 and the vision for 2050.
- Consolidated explanatory report; summary report.
- System of planning maps and database. Maps with a scale of form 1:50.000 to 1:1.000.000, including: current state map and orientation for environmental zoning (strictly protected areas and emission control areas); current state map and orientation for conservation of nature and biodiversity; current state map and orientation for establishment of areas for concentrated treatment of solid wastes and hazardous wastes at national, regional and provincial levels; current state map and orientation for establishment of national, regional and provincial environment warning and monitoring networks; current state map and orientation for environmental protection (environmental zoning, conservation of nature and biodiversity; areas for concentrated treatment of solid wastes and hazardous wastes; environment warning and monitoring networks).
- Report on responses to opinions offered by Ministries, central authorities and local governments on the planning and the documents that contain these opinions.
- Appraisal report prepared by the appraising authority.
- Report on responses to opinions offered by the appraising authority.
b) Quantity: 05 set of printed documents and a CD that has contents of all planning documents.
c) Formats of planning documents:
- Physical documents, including the consolidated explanatory report, summary report, draft decision or planning approval and thematic explanatory reports, shall be printed in colors on A4 pages.
- Current state maps and planning maps shall be printed in colors on a scale of from 1:50.000 to 1:1.000.000.
6. Sources of funding for planning
a) The funding for development of the National Environmental Protection Planning shall be extracted from the sources of funding public investment prescribed by planning laws and relevant laws.
b) On the basis of the national environmental protection planning tasks approved by the Prime Minister and guidance of the Ministry of Planning and Investment regarding planning norms, guidance of the Ministry of Finance on pricing, other regulations on expenditure norms and limits, the Minister of Natural Resources and Environment shall organize the cost estimation, verify and decide the estimated costs of National Environmental Protection Planning in accordance with regulations of law on public investment and relevant laws.
Article 2. Implementation organization
1. The Ministry of Natural Resources and Environment shall:
- Approve detailed contents and cost estimates of projects; appoint planning units in accordance with applicable regulations.
- Take charge and cooperate with other Ministries, central authorities and organizations in performing the planning tasks approved by the Prime Minister; ensure quality, punctuality and effectiveness.
2. Other Ministries, central authorities, the People’s Committees of provinces and central-affiliated cities shall cooperate with the Ministry of Natural Resources and Environment in formulation of the National Environmental Protection Planning tasks during 2021 – 2030 and the vision for 2050; ensure effectiveness and punctuality.
Article 3. This Decision comes into force from the day on which it is signed.
The Minister of Natural Resources and Environment, the Minister of Planning and Investment, the Minister of Construction, the Minister of Agriculture and Rural Development, the Minister of Industry and Trade, the Minister of Transport, Presidents of the People’s Committees of provinces and central-affiliated cities, other Ministries, central authorities and local governments shall be responsible for the implementation of this Decision./.
